如何启动docker内服务器

不及物动词 其他 42

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要启动Docker内的服务器,可以按照以下步骤进行操作:

    1. 安装Docker:首先,确保您的计算机上已经安装了Docker。您可以从Docker官方网站上下载适用于您的操作系统的适当版本,并按照官方文档中的说明进行安装。

    2. 获取服务器镜像:接下来,您需要获取一个适用于服务器的Docker镜像。Docker镜像是一个预配置的环境,可以用来运行特定的服务器应用程序。您可以通过在Docker Hub或其他镜像仓库中搜索相关的镜像,并选择合适的镜像。

    3. 拉取镜像:一旦确定了适当的镜像,使用以下命令来拉取镜像至本地:

    docker pull 镜像名称:标签
    

    例如,如果要拉取名为"nginx"的最新版本镜像,可以使用以下命令:

    docker pull nginx:latest
    
    1. 运行容器:拉取完毕后,使用以下命令来运行容器:
    docker run -d --name 任意容器名称 -p 主机端口:容器端口 镜像名称:标签
    

    其中,"-d"选项表示容器在后台运行,"–name"选项用于指定容器名称,"-p"选项用于指定主机端口与容器端口的映射关系。

    例如,要使用刚才拉取的nginx镜像在主机的80端口运行一个容器,可以使用以下命令:

    docker run -d --name mynginx -p 80:80 nginx:latest
    
    1. 检查容器状态:使用以下命令可以查看容器的状态:
    docker ps
    

    上述命令将显示正在运行的容器的列表,您应该能够在列表中看到刚刚创建的容器。

    至此,您已成功启动了一个Docker内的服务器。您可以通过访问主机的IP地址和指定的端口,来访问该服务器。例如,在浏览器中输入"http://localhost"或"http://主机IP地址",即可访问刚刚运行的nginx服务器。

    希望上述步骤对您有所帮助!

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    启动Docker容器内的服务器需要以下步骤:

    1. 安装Docker:首先,您需要在您的计算机上安装Docker,可以从Docker官方网站(https://www.docker.com/)下载并按照指导进行安装。

    2. 创建Docker镜像:在启动Docker服务器之前,您需要创建一个包含所需服务器的Docker镜像。您可以使用Dockerfile来定义镜像的配置,包括安装软件、设置环境变量等。通过执行docker build命令可以根据Dockerfile创建一个镜像。

    3. 启动Docker容器:一旦您创建了Docker镜像,接下来就可以通过执行docker run命令来启动Docker容器。在命令中,您需要指定所使用的镜像,以及其他配置参数,如端口映射、挂载数据卷等。

    4. 访问Docker服务器:一旦Docker容器启动成功,您可以使用容器的IP地址和端口号来访问其中的服务器。如果容器的端口已经映射到主机上的某个端口,可以直接通过主机的IP地址和映射的端口号来访问服务器。

    5. 进入Docker容器:如果您需要在Docker容器内部执行操作,您可以使用docker exec命令来在运行中的容器中执行命令。通过指定容器的ID或名称以及要执行的命令,您可以在容器内部运行命令,如安装软件、修改配置文件等。

    总结:要启动Docker内的服务器,首先需要安装Docker,然后创建一个包含所需服务器的Docker镜像,接着使用docker run命令启动Docker容器,并通过IP地址和端口号访问服务器。如果需要在容器内部执行操作,可以使用docker exec命令进入容器。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    启动一个Docker容器中的服务器需要经过以下步骤:

    1. 配置Docker环境:首先,确保在您的系统上安装了Docker。您可以从Docker官方网站(https://www.docker.com/)下载并安装适用于您操作系统的Docker。

    2. 下载服务器镜像:在Docker容器中运行服务器前,您需要下载相应的服务器镜像。Docker镜像是一个可重复部署的轻量级软件包,包含了服务器的所有依赖项。您可以在Docker Hub(https://hub.docker.com/)上查找各种镜像,比如Nginx、Apache、Tomcat等。

    3. 创建Docker容器:一旦您下载了所需的服务器镜像,接下来需要创建一个容器来运行服务器。运行以下命令来创建一个容器:

    docker run -d --name myserver -p 80:80 <镜像名称>
    

    这个命令会在后台创建一个名为“myserver”的容器,并将主机的80端口映射到容器的80端口上。您可以根据需要修改端口映射的设置。

    1. 启动容器:运行以下命令来启动刚刚创建的容器:
    docker start myserver
    

    这个命令会启动名为“myserver”的容器,并开始运行服务器。

    1. 测试服务器:一旦容器启动,您可以使用浏览器或命令行工具来测试服务器是否成功启动。在浏览器中访问“http://localhost”(如果您在步骤3中修改了端口映射,请使用相应的端口)。如果一切正常,您应该能够看到服务器的默认欢迎页面。

    2. 停止容器:如果您需要停止容器,可以运行以下命令:

    docker stop myserver
    

    这个命令会停止名为“myserver”的容器并关闭其中运行的服务器。

    以上是启动Docker容器中服务器的基本步骤。您可以根据具体的服务器和应用需求,调整相关参数和配置,以实现更高级的功能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部